#0404d6 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0404d6 is composed of 1.6% red, 1.6% green and 83.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 98.1% cyan, 98.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 16.1% black. It has a hue angle of 240 degrees, a saturation of 96.3% and a lightness of 42.7%. #0404d6 color hex could be obtained by blending #0808ff with #0000ad. Closest websafe color is: #0000cc.

#0404d6 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#0404d6 has RGB values of R:4, G:4, B:214 and CMYK values of C:0.98, M:0.98, Y:0,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 263382.

Shades and Tints of #0404d6
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000002 is the darkest color, while #eeee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#0404d6
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#696971 is the less saturated color, while #0404d6 is the most saturated one.
